H1B Visa Sponsorship Overview

University of California at Santa Barbara, based in Santa Barbara, CA, has filed 961 H1B labor condition applications with the U.S. Department of Labor since FY2008.

The average salary offered on H1B applications is $68,503. This is -56.3% compared to the national median salary of $132,500 for the most common position, Biophysicists.

University of California at Santa Barbara has also filed 122 green card (PERM) applications, with 42 certified, indicating long-term sponsorship commitment for foreign workers. Green Card Sponsor

University of California at Santa Barbara operates in the Educational Services industry.
